A rain chamber—also known as a water spray tester or rain test chamber—is an environmental simulation device that replicates real-world rain exposure, road splash, and high-pressure washdowns through programmable water spray systems. A stackable battery is an energy storage solution made up of several battery modules arranged in a stack. These modules are linked either in series or parallel to enhance the system's total capacity and voltage. Think of it like LEGO bricks for electricity: snap together what you need today, add more blocks. . [PDF Version]
